Ticket: Staging env misconfigured for Siftgate bloom filter

The bloom layer in front of the Pellet KV store is rejecting all lookups in staging because the env file was copied from the dev template without credentials. False-positive tuning values are fine; only the auth line is missing. To unblock the weekly demo, the Pellet admission secret must be set on the following line.

env line for yaguf-fajop: LEDGER_TOKEN13=fb08984397349

## Configuration

Pagination for the Fernwick public API is controlled entirely by env vars. `FERNWICK_PAGE_SIZE` sets the default page length (max 200). `FERNWICK_CURSOR_TTL` controls how long opaque cursors stay valid, in seconds — keep it under 900 or the cache bloats. Don't hardcode either; staging and prod differ. Copy `env.sample` to `.env`, adjust the two values above, and confirm the service boots. Then add the cursor-signing secret on the very next line:

vault entry, yahif-yajep: COURIER_KEY29=b802bdf8034096b65a51c6ba5abe2

### Step 3: Resolve duplicate event rows

As discussed at sync, the Meridline calendar sync produced duplicate events wherever a recurring series was edited during the outage window. This step dedupes by series key, keeping the row with the latest modification stamp, and marks losers as tombstoned rather than deleting them. Run the dedupe script in dry-run mode first and paste the summary in the tracker. The script connects to the sync database using the connection string below.

primary connection of yagep-kahip = redis://giliel_svc:zYiKsLL2PLpfPL@db-348f.xolmarsys.corp:5432/fenwyn